Output a8253fdbdab83e50982dfd79a1e8f71e44b9b08584898eaab5ebbf9df2b73625:3

value
51314981
script pubkey
OP_0 OP_PUSHBYTES_32 29f1786088005e2be42d3ba778cfed2fd67b36f58c6d54d179a2bf33827bcb1f
address
bc1q98chscygqp0zhepd8wnh3nld9lt8kdh433k4f5te52ln8qnmev0sguvpe6
transaction
a8253fdbdab83e50982dfd79a1e8f71e44b9b08584898eaab5ebbf9df2b73625
confirmations
154791
spent
true